Junior Ryon Howard (Bronx, NY) scored a career-high 20 points, while senior Drew Shubik (Stoystown, PA) added 18 to lead the Sacred Heart University men's basketball team to an 87-82 win over visiting Fairleigh Dickinson University in a Northeast Conference game Thursday night.
The get the win, the Pioneers had to overcome the one-two punch of FDU's Sean Baptiste and Manny Ubilla who combined to pour in 61 of the Knight's 82 points. Baptiste, a sophomore, had a career-high 33, while Ubilla finished with 28.
Sacred Heart, 8-10 overall and 5-2 in the conference, took an early 10-8 lead on a Howard dunk but FDU used a 12-4 run to take a 20-14 lead with 11:42 left in the first half. Eric Hazard finished off the run with a three-pointer that gave the Knights the biggest lead it would have in the game.
The Pioneers then used three straight treys by Shubik and two from sophomore Corey Hassan (Merrimack, NH) to retake the lead at 23-20 with 9:54 to go in the half. SHU would never trail again. Another Shubik three gave the Pioneers their biggest lead of the half, 35-27, with 7:05 to and they would parlay that into a 47-39 lead at the intermission.
Shubik gave SHU its first double-digit lead at 53-43 with a layup two minutes into the second half. In fact, it looked like the Knights were about to get blown out of the building when they trailed after a Hassan bucket, 72-55, with 10:32 to play.
FDU, 5-10 and 1-4, had too much Baptiste and Ubilla however to just go away. A Baptiste three with with 6:42 left had the Knights back within eight at 76-68. A free throw by Brice Brooks with 4:00 left had the Pioneers back up ten at 81-70. A 9-3 Knight run, capped by a Ubilla layup cut the SHU lead to just five, 84-79 with 1:31 left.
The Pioneers tried to use the clock, but FDU fouled Shubik with 1:11 to play and he made one of two to push the lead back to six. After Hazard missed a three at the other end, Howard answered with a dunk to put the Knights away. Ubilla drained one more three with :13 left for the final score. He finished the contest 6-10 from three-point range.
Brooks finished with 16 points and eight boards for the Pioneers, while Hassan was also in double digits with 15 points. Shubik added six assists and five steals to his scoring totals. Sacred Heart finished the game shooting 54 percent from the floor (34-63).
